DIY Flower Headdress (Tutorial), Mint Deer Sweater c/o Romwe, Vintage Lace Skirt from Wasteland, UO Bag, Colin Stuart Wedges

Hope you guys caught the play on words in the title! ;) I recently went on a huge pastel binge after realizing that there was too much black taking over my closet! I was looking around on Romwe for some sweaters at the time as well and I saw this mint one! It's on the thin side, but you'd be surprised how warm it still keeps you! o.o But I do also think that shredding tends to look better on thinner fabrics.

I chose to style this sweater with my vintage lace skirt (which I got from the LA Wasteland for only $16!) which I wanted to have peeking out at the bottom. I also wore my floral headdress that I made myself (tutorial is linked above), and these wedges from Victoria Secret that were only $12 or so online. They have really great online sales especially in the shoe sections so if you've never checked it out, you definitely should next time!
